  • Are You a Leader?
    .
    Seven basic leadership traits can help you run your business. Best of all, these qualities can be learned and are not just for "natural born leaders".

    Emotional stability, dominance, enthusiasm, conscientiousness, tough-mindedness, self-assurance, and compulsiveness are the qualities experts have identified as keys to great leadership.

    Review your strengths. What talents do you already have? Which ones do you want to develop and improve?

    Many Businesses Overpaid their Taxes!
    .
    Over 3,600 small businesses have wrongly paid Alternative Minimum Tax since November, 2000, according to the Associated Press.

    If your business did not have a knowledgeable accountant prepare its taxes, check now that you have not paid too much tax!

    In 1997, Congress exempted businesses with average gross receipts of $7.5 million or less from the alternative minimum tax, but many continued to pay.
